Face up left facing, stamped will be right facing Tjaps, pronounced chops, are beautiful copper batik stamps used to apply wax in the batik process. Our artisans in Indonesia handcraft these tjaps from narrow rolls of copper and copper wire, using simple tools but achieving very sophisticated effects. While designed to stamp wax patterns into fabric, tjaps are also useful to fiber and mixed media
